1 + 1没有什么特殊含义。SELECT 1 + 1 AS solution 等价于 SELECT 2 AS solution,就类似写 Hello World 程序 let solution = 1 + 1 一样。真实场景下,SELECT 2 AS solution 这样的查询无意义,但这里是用来测试连接数据库是否成功,需要一个足够简单且总是成立(无需数据库中已有数据)的 SQL 语句。 有用 ...
这个SELECT语法把选定的列直接存储到变量。因此,只有单一的行可以被取回。SELECT id,data INTO x,y FROM test.t1 LIMIT 1;注意,用户变量名在MySQL 5.1中是对大小写不敏感的。请参阅9.3节,“用户变量”。重要: SQL变量名不能和列名一样。如果SELECT ... INTO这样的SQL语句包含一个对列的参考...
select 1,选择第一个数据库 使用set关键字插入数据 set name andashu 使用get 关键字获取数据 get name 使用del 关键字 删除数据 del name Memcached ➡️Memcached简介 Memcached是一个高性能的分布式的内存对象缓存系统,目前全世界不少人使用这个缓存项目来构建自己大负载的网站,来分担数据库的压力,通过在内存里...
在Python中,显得很容易理解,因为print给学习者的印象,就是打印的意思,但是select就不一样,它的表面意思是选择(表中哪都没有常量,怎么选择?这会陷入一个疑惑。),这导致很多人在MySQL中打印常量,显得无法理解。 还是劝你记住那句话:select就是...
接下来,我们就先来研究一下这个执行计划里比较重要的字段都是什么意思。 (1)id 这个id呢,就是说每个SELECT都会对应一个id,其实说白了,就是一个复杂的SQL里可能会有很多个SELECT,也可能会包含多条执行计划,每一条执行计划都会有一个唯一的id,这个没啥好说的。
上述语句利用SELECT语句从products表中检索一个名为prod_name的列。选择什么 —— prod_name列;从什么地方选 —— products表。 形式: SELECT 列名 FROM 表名; (列应该是表中的列) 输出: 如图 注释: 1 你可能得到不同的顺序。这很正常。如果没有排序的话,顺序是随机的。只要数据正确即可。
select_type:子查询的种类 1、SIMPLE:简单的select查询,查询中不包含子查询或者union 2、PRIMARY:查询中包含任何复杂的子部分,最外层查询则被标记为primary 3、SUBQUERY:在select 或 where列表中包含了子查询 4、DERIVED:在from列表中包含的子查询被标记为derived(衍生),mysql或递归执行这些子查询,把结果放在临时表里...
SELECT:普通的查询语句,用于读取数据。当前读、快照读、MVCC之间的关系 当前读和快照读是MVCC中两种不...
这是mysql的默认隔离级别,与第二种不同的是,此时如果和你操作一张表的另一个人commit后,你select查询后依旧是1 小明,只有当你自己commit之后,当前事务完全结束后,你才可以看到修改后的值,这种隔离级别解决了不可重复读的问题,但是出现了一种新的问题,就是幻读,什么是幻读呢?举个例子,当你查询某条数据时,可能...
快照读:读取的是快照数据,不加锁的简单的SELECT都属于快照读(只是普通的读操作)。当前读:当前读就...